Eyelashes often grow after they are cut, and they often grow for about a week. Therefore, many patients with trichiasis like to go to the hospital to let the doctor pull out their eyelashes, but they will soon grow out again. Therefore, we must attach great importance to the health of the eyes at ordinary times. If there is trichiasis, see if it shows eyelid entropion. We can carry out corrective surgery for eyelid entropion. Do not rub your eyes with your hands or cut your eyelashes. Cutting eyelashes is likely to damage the cornea and may also show conjunctival inflammation. Therefore, we must protect our eyes at ordinary times.
